Layout and circulation

Plan the galley configuration so the island supports both prep and seating without blocking movement. In practice allow 1.1–1.2 metres of clear walkway on each side of the island to enable two people to pass and to accommodate three stools comfortably. Place the integrated sink and cooktop to create an efficient working flow and minimise cross-traffic between prep, cooking and refrigeration. In taller units where the window is the primary natural source, keep upper storage low and horizontal to draw light into the kitchen and maintain an open feel. Consider pull-out trays and vertical organisers at the ends of runs to improve access in narrow spaces.

Material and finish palette

A restrained material palette keeps the narrow plan coherent: warm walnut veneer for the waterfall island provides a tactile anchor; matte white lower cabinetry preserves brightness; and dark grey or black polished stone for the countertop and backsplash introduces depth and durability. Stainless-steel appliances offer resilience and a crisp contrast, while polished or sealed concrete flooring complements the concrete-look ceiling. Use consistent wood tones and matte finishes to avoid visual competition and to keep the composition calm. Lighting hierarchy and atmosphere

Layered lighting is vital in a Modern galley kitchen Dubai design to serve task, ambient and accent needs. A trio of matte black pendant lights above the island supplies focused task light and a strong visual anchor. Recessed spotlights and under-cabinet lighting ensure even illumination across the workrun, while a linear cove LED in the ceiling recess provides soft ambient glow that visually broadens the gallery. Add a freestanding floor lamp near the window to introduce a warm, human-scaled light for evenings and to soften the concrete surfaces. Night-time city views through the narrow window can become part of the kitchen’s ambience—balance privacy with sheer or blackout options depending on orientation.

Storage strategies and styling

Smart storage keeps the galley tidy and functional: opt for deep, handleless drawers for pots and pans; pullout pantry modules beside the oven tower for organised dry goods; and integrated bins within the island to manage waste and recycling. Use open shelving sparingly for curated items—uniform tableware, a neat fruit bowl and a couple of decorative objects—to avoid visual clutter. Consistent organisation makes daily routines effortless in a compact plan. Concealed charging stations and appliance garages keep surfaces clean and maintain the streamlined look that defines the style.

Ventilation and mechanical considerations

Ventilation is especially important in a narrow plan to prevent lingering odours and to protect finishes. Where possible specify a high-capacity canopy hood with external ducting. If external venting is limited, choose a powerful island or downdraft unit sized to the cooktop’s output; check CFM ratings carefully and plan service access for filters. Also consider ventilation paths to adjacent rooms and add a heat-resistant splash behind cooking zones to prolong material life. For Dubai installations, corrosion-resistant ductwork and easily serviceable hoods help manage both humidity and dust exposure.

FAQ

Is polished concrete flooring a good choice for a Dubai kitchen?

Yes. Polished concrete is durable, easy to maintain and works well with underfloor heating if required. Use a quality sealer and add rugs in adjacent seating or dining areas to soften the feel and reduce slipperiness. Choose a finish with a light-reflective polish to help brighten narrow plans that have limited daylight penetration.

How many stools can fit comfortably at a waterfall island?

Allow roughly 60cm (24 inches) per stool for comfortable seating. A typical galley island sized for three stools provides adequate elbow room while preserving circulation on both sides. For a more luxurious feel increase the spacing slightly and choose slimmer stool silhouettes so the walkway remains generous.

What ventilation is recommended for a narrow galley kitchen?

A high-capacity canopy hood with external venting is the preferred solution for rapid extraction. Where external ducting is impractical, specify a high-performance island or downdraft system and ensure the unit’s extraction rate matches your cooktop’s output. Regular maintenance of filters and corrosion-resistant components is particularly important in Dubai’s climate.

How do I combine dark backsplashes with light cabinetry?

Balance strong contrast with warmth: pair a dark backsplash with matte white lower units and a warm walnut island to bridge tones. Maintain low, horizontal upper storage to keep the kitchen bright and visually open, and use consistent metal finishes to tie dark and light elements together.

Are open shelves practical in a busy kitchen?

Open shelves can work if curated and regularly edited. Store uniform dishware and limit display objects to keep shelves tidy. Reserve open shelving for frequently used items or decorative pieces that support the overall palette, and consider glass-fronted cabinets for a similar visual effect with more protection from dust.

What lighting layers are essential for a modern kitchen?

Combine task lighting (pendants, under-cabinet or recessed spots), ambient lighting (cove LEDs or ceiling fixtures) and accent lighting (floor lamps or directional spots). Layering light supports cooking, dining and evening moods while making a narrow galley feel more generous. Dimmable circuits give flexibility for both bright task scenes and softer entertaining atmospheres.
